Indigenisation of Defence Equipment: Indian Army Inducts 5 Metre Short Span Bridge

 

NEW DELHI. In another inspring example of indigenisation of defence equipment, a five metre short span bridge was formally handed over to the Indian Army in a ceremony at the Talegaon facility of Larsen & Toubro Limited on March 20.

The Bridge is indigenously designed & developed and is the result of close coordination between the Corps of Engineers and the DRDO laboratory at Pune R&DE (Engineers). The equipment has been manufactured by Larsen & Toubro Limited and has been delivered three months ahead of schedule. All stakeholders have put in concerted efforts to overcome challenges and realise the ‘Make in India’ initiative of the government, which aims to ensure self sufficiency in India’s defence needs.

The Bridge would meet the important requirement of providing mobility to own forces by speedy establishment of bridges and was one of the numerous indigenous projects of Corps of Engineers, which have made significant progress and were nearing induction and would soon join the units of Corps of Engineers.
